Sulphur defined Caltanissetta for over a century. From the 1830s until the industry's collapse in the mid-twentieth century, mines across the province extracted the yellow mineral that powered Europe's chemical and fertilizer sectors. At peak production around 1900, Sicily supplied roughly 80 percent of the world's sulphur. The Museo Mineralogico on Via Giudici preserves geological specimens and mining equipment from that era. Caltanissetta, positioned near the geographic centre of Sicily with approximately 62,800 inhabitants, remains the provincial capital despite losing much of its economic base when the last mines closed.

Holy Week processions rank among the most elaborate in Sicily. The Real Maestranza, a confraternity of artisans established in the sixteenth century, organizes the Giovedi Santo procession through the old town, carrying life-sized sculptural groups (vare) depicting the Passion. On Good Friday, a separate procession of the Black Christ draws crowds from across the island. These traditions reflect an intensity of popular devotion characteristic of interior Sicily.

The Castello di Pietrarossa, ruined but still visible on a rocky spur east of the centre, dates to the Arab-Norman period. Caltanissetta's economy now relies on public-sector employment and agriculture, particularly durum wheat and olive cultivation on the surrounding hillsides. The SS640 motorway extension toward Agrigento, completed in stages from 2019, has improved road connections to the southern coast.
